摘要
The wireless network landscape is changing gradually from homogeneous to heterogeneous and future generation networks are envisioned to be a combination of diverse but complimentary access technologies, like GPRS, WCDMA/HSPA, LTE, WiMAX, and WLAN. One issue which has become apparent recently with the proliferation of different link layer technologies is how service providers can offer a consistent service across heterogeneous networks and also across access networks that they don't own themselves. The paper presents the current inter-working technologies and preferred ones, and schemes that provide QoS. This paper highlights some open issues that need to be addressed in order to enable multi-access mobility. The paper shows that inter-working between access technologies should be limited to only those where there exists a strong business case or operator interest.
